Purpose and Functionality
A car amplifier is designed to amplify the audio signal from a source, such as a head unit or a phone, and send it to the speakers. Its primary function is to increase the power and clarity of the audio signal, allowing drivers to enjoy a more immersive and satisfying driving experience. The amplifier’s primary components include:
- Power Output: This refers to the maximum wattage that the amplifier can produce, measured in watts per channel (WPC). A higher power output indicates a more powerful amplifier that can drive more demanding speakers.
- Frequency Response: This refers to the range of frequencies that the amplifier can produce, measured in Hertz (Hz). A wider frequency response indicates a more versatile amplifier that can handle a broader range of audio signals.
- Class of Amplification: This refers to the type of amplification technology used in the amplifier. Common types of amplification include Class A, Class B, and Class D.
Key Components and Their Impact on Sound Performance
Understanding the key components of a car amplifier is essential for selecting the right model for your vehicle’s audio system. Here are some key components and their impact on sound performance:
- Power Output: The power output of an amplifier directly affects the sound quality it produces. A higher power output indicates a more powerful amplifier that can drive more demanding speakers and produce a more immersive audio experience.
- Frequency Response: The frequency response of an amplifier is critical in determining the clarity and accuracy of the audio signal. A wider frequency response indicates a more versatile amplifier that can handle a broader range of audio signals, producing a more nuanced and engaging audio experience.
- Class of Amplification: The class of amplification used in an amplifier affects its efficiency, heat generation, and overall performance. Class A amplifiers are known for their high-quality sound, but are often less efficient and generate more heat. Class D amplifiers are more efficient and produce less heat, but may sacrifice some sound quality.
